当前位置:首页 » 编程软件 » 网页登陆脚本

网页登陆脚本

发布时间: 2024-06-14 22:05:55

python+selenium自动化写登录脚本时,弹出的第三方登录页面该如何定位元素

importtime
defBai():
try:
browser=webdriver.Chrome()
browser.get(url)
wait=WebDriverWait(browser,10)
#定位网络登陆按钮
browser.find_element_by_xpath('//*[@id="u1"]/a[7]').click()
time.sleep(5)
#qq登陆
browser.find_element_by_xpath('//*[@id="pass_phoenix_btn"]/ul/li[1]/a').click()
#切换至qq登陆窗口
time.sleep(5)
browser.switch_to.window(browser.window_handles[1])
#切换至账户密码框
browser.switch_to.frame('ptlogin_iframe')
#账户登陆按钮
browser.find_element_by_xpath('//*[@id="switcher_plogin"]').click()

user=browser.find_element_by_id('u')
user.send_keys(账户)

password=browser.find_element_by_id('p')
password.send_keys(密码)
browser.find_element_by_id('login_button').click()
browser.switch_to.window(browser.window_handles[0])

finally:
browser.close()
Bai()

Ⅱ 想用python编写一个脚本,登录网页,在网页里做一系列操作,应该怎样实现

python编写一个脚本的腊厅具体操作:

1、首先,打开python并创建一个新的PY文件。

Ⅲ 如何编写脚本自动登录网页

python,网上登陆网页的代码很多。个人很喜欢用python,所以推荐

Ⅳ 求用IE浏览器打开一个链接,并输入账号密码登陆的VBS脚本(链接只能用IE打开)。

  1. 遨游和TT用的扮没链都是IE的内核,如果你用的这察雀种游览器,WScript.CreateObject("InternetExplorer.Application") 就不会启动IE,如果确定你用的浏览器打不开你说的网页,那只能建议换个浏览器.....(不过我觉得应该能打开,都是IE内核)

  2. 在ie.navigate URL后面可以加一段

    Do while IE.ReadyState <> 4 or IE.busy

    wscript.sleep 10

    loop

  3. SendKeys方式不太保险,最好是IE.document.getElementbyID这样然后厅孙去赋值(不过这个方式要看到你网页的具体源代码才行)

  4. HKEY_CURRENT_ 下面加一个开机的自启动项,值是指向这个vbs文件 ,就可以实现开机启动,

  5. 添加一个"计划任务"也能实现开机启动

热点内容
切鱼解压 发布:2025-05-09 13:41:11 浏览:476
编译原理实验pl0 发布:2025-05-09 13:18:03 浏览:606
银行贷款ftp 发布:2025-05-09 13:10:56 浏览:462
思域后排有哪些配置 发布:2025-05-09 13:00:55 浏览:200
图像的二值化算法 发布:2025-05-09 12:55:29 浏览:757
解压刮面 发布:2025-05-09 12:30:35 浏览:641
易语言脚本教程视频 发布:2025-05-09 12:10:54 浏览:560
sql中变量查询 发布:2025-05-09 12:05:32 浏览:182
phpajax表格数据 发布:2025-05-09 12:04:46 浏览:826
美国真人秀ftp 发布:2025-05-09 11:34:41 浏览:405